A Guide to Foster Care Support in Nebraska

Navigating the foster care system can be challenging, and knowing where to turn help is crucial. Luckily, Nebraska offers a range of resources for foster families, prospective individuals, and the children in care.

Here are some key agencies that can provide guidance:

  • The Nebraska Department of Health and Human Services
  • Nebraska Children and Services
  • Local Foster Care Agencies
  • Non-profit Groups Dedicated to Foster Care Support

These organizations can provide a wealth of programs, including:

  • Workshops for Foster Parents
  • Financial Aid
  • Mental Health and Support Services
  • Childcare Arrangements
